Based on the Australian Bureau of Statistics 2021 Census (ABS), Loomberah has around 21,166 private dwellings, home to approximately 48,239 people. With an average household size of 2.5 people, and around 50 litres of hot water used per person each day in Australia, Loomberah households use approximately 125 litres of hot water daily, equating to a massive 2.6 million litres of hot water used across the suburb every single day.
Other census insights reinforce Loomberah's suitability for energy-saving improvements like energy-efficient or solar-powered hot water. The Loomberah community is home to 3,839 couple families with children and 1,579 one-parent families, meaning a large proportion of households face substantial hot water demand. With 6,069 homes owned with a mortgage and 6,129 owned outright, many residents also have the homeownership and growing equity that make switching to efficient hot water systems a practical way to lower expenses.
Loomberah is converting hot water demand to efficient systems faster than many peers, with 9.4% of dwellings already upgraded.

Recent data shows 1,980 efficient hot water installations (heat pump and solar hot water installation combined) recorded across the 2340 postcode. Installations peaked around 2009–2011 with over 1,200 systems put in during those three years, then settled into a steady stream of upgrades from 2016 onwards. This trend reflects growing interest in electrification, lower running costs and moving away from gas hot water, with more households asking about solar hot water vs electric hot water and the best heat pump hot water system for their situation.
Typical annual bill savings in Loomberah look like this:
• Old electric to heat pump hot water installation: save about $350–$700 per year. • Gas storage to heat pump hot water: save roughly $250–$600 per year. • Gas to solar hot water installation: save around $250–$550 per year. • Old electric to modern electric hot water installation with solar: save about $200–$450 per year.
Upfront hot water system price / cost depends on size and brand. Heat pump hot water price / cost is usually higher than a basic electric unit, while solar hot water price / cost varies with collector type and tank size. But once you factor in a solar hot water rebate, a heat pump hot water rebate or an electric hot water system rebate where applicable, the real cost can fall sharply. Federal Small‑scale Technology Certificates (STCs) apply to eligible systems, and NSW programs can offer additional hot water rebate NSW support for efficient upgrades. These incentives can cut the installed cost by a substantial percentage and shorten payback to just a few years, especially if you already have solar.
